  • What are good engine compression test results?

    “Good” compression depends on the engine.
    Unfortunately, engines don't come with their proper compression stamped on the outside.
    But a good rule of thumb says that each cylinder in a mechanically sound engine should have compression of 130 psi or higher..

  • What does a engine compression test tell you?

    A compression test is to determine how much pressure the engine makes, and a leakdown test measures its ability to hold pressure.
    Atmospheric pressure at sea level is approximately 14.7 psi.
    A 9:1 compression ratio cylinder is compressing the air and fuel mixture to about 132 psi at sea level (9x14. 7=132.3).Aug 15, 2019.

  • What does a running compression test verify?

    The advantage of a running compression test is that it gives you an idea of the volumetric efficiency of each cylinder.
    In other words, how efficiently each cylinder is pulling air in, retaining it for the correct amount of time, then releasing it into the exhaust..

  • What is an engine compression test an indicator of?

    It checks the sealing of the cylinder under pressure and the piston rings' ability to keep the compression gases working against the piston crown instead of escaping into the oil pan.
    It also is an indicator of the ability of the valve to seal against the seat and make an airtight bore..

A compression test reveals the condition of your engine's valves, its valve seats, and piston rings and whether these parts are wearing evenly. Healthy engines should have compression over 100 psi per cylinder, with no more than 10 percent variation between the highest and lowest readings.

How do you know if a cylinder has a compression leak?

If the compression doesn't change, this indicates a compression leak via the head gasket and, in a few cases, a cracked cylinder head or block.
If the compression increases, this indicates a compression leak via a worn-out piston ring or cylinder.

How Much Does Compression Testing Cost?

Usually, an engine compression test could cost anywhere between $141 and $178.
This cost is essentially the labor charges that may vary as per your location and your vehicle make and model.
Based on the test readings, the mechanic may also suggest certain auto repairs that would costextra.

What happens if you run a compression test on a cold engine?

Warm up your engine to operating temperature.
Piston rings, valve seats, and other critical components are designed to expand as they heat, which creates the desired compression ratio inside the engine.
If you complete a compression test on a cold engine, the reading will be inaccurate.

When Do I Need A Compression Test?

Usually, you need a compression test if your car experiences any of the following symptoms:.
1) Smoke comes from the exhaust system when you accelerate or decelerate.
2) The engine feels sluggish when you accelerate.
3) The engine vibrates when driving down the road.
4) The engine runs hot.

A Stirling engine is a heat engine operating by cyclic compression and expansion of air or other gas, the working fluid, at different temperature levels such that there is a net conversion of heat to mechanical work.
The Stirling cycle heat engine can also be driven in reverse, using a mechanical energy input to drive heat transfer in a reversed direction.

The Chevrolet small-block engine is a series of gasoline-powered V8 automobile engines, produced by the Chevrolet division of General Motors between 1954 and 2003, using the same basic engine block.
Referred to as a small-block for its size relative to the physically much larger Chevrolet big-block engines, the small block family spanned from 262 cu in (4.3 L) to 400 cu in (6.6 L) in displacement.
Engineer Ed Cole is credited with leading the design for this engine.
The engine block and cylinder heads were cast at Saginaw Metal Casting Operations in Saginaw, Michigan.

The Chevrolet Turbo-Air 6 is a flat-six air-cooled automobile engine developed by General Motors (GM) in the late 1950s for use in the rear-engined Chevrolet Corvair of the 1960s.
It was used in the entire Corvair line, as well as a wide variety of other applications.

The diesel engine, named after Rudolf Diesel, is an internal combustion engine in which ignition of the fuel is caused by the elevated temperature of the air in the cylinder due to mechanical compression; thus, the diesel engine is called a compression-ignition engine.
This contrasts with engines using spark plug-ignition of the air-fuel mixture, such as a petrol engine or a gas engine.
